Expect More Attacks On Scriptures In 2018, Cleric Tells Christians

Senior Pastor, Truth Aflame International Church, Warri, Rev. Goddowell Ivworin, has revealed that the church will experience more attacks on scriptures in 2018, urging the church to brace up for this.
Speaking to Oasis Magazine (OM) during an exclusive chat in Warri recently, Rev. Ivworin opined that the church witnessed an attack on scriptural doctrines in 2017, saying that clerics must be careful with what they preach and write.
His words: “In 2018 there is a preparation to shoot different arrows, with the aim of attempting to bring out evidence to attempt to show that the Bible is fake and a book written by men.”
He added that this move by the enemies of the church is also targeted at Christians with the aim of confusing them.
According to him, this was a divine message to the church, stressing that the church must stand firm in the Word which is the truth.
He continued: “Presently, the attack now is on church finances. It is a mission in disguise as if it is geared towards helping the poor, when in the real sense it is to prevent Christians from carrying out their obligations in the areas of offerings and tithing.”
Ivworin called on clerics and believers to study, adding that church leaders should desist from responding to critics rashly and placing curses on them, but rather use scriptures to counter them.
